Q: Is 56,327 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 56,327 is not a prime number.

Why is 56,327 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 56327 can be evenly divided by 1 23 31 79 713 1,817 2,449 and 56,327, with no remainder.

Since 56,327 cannot be divided by just 1 and 56,327, it is not a prime number.
